Stolen or lost Car Keys
If your car keys were stolen, you need to report the theft immediately. This may require a police report or it could be as easy as repeating the steps. You should also check with your auto insurance company to determine if the loss is covered. In addition you should think about changing the locks at your home to avoid unauthorized entry.
A professional locksmith for cars can reprogramme a lost key in some cases. This could save you time and money. You'll need to provide evidence such as a V5C certificate or driving license to facilitate the process.
The cost to program the new key fob is contingent on the year of your vehicle and make. The cost of replacing the chip inside the latest model of car can be up to $1000. The process is simpler for older models.
Modern cars make use of advanced technology to guard against theft. The days of standard turn-key ignitions are gone. A lot of cars now have electronic keys that incorporate transponder technology into the remote fobs. These smart keys have to be programmed in order to be able to start the car. Dealers can reprogramme them, however, it is long.
Always choose a car locksmith with a good reputation. A legitimate locksmith will be willing to explain the process and respond to any questions you might have without attempting to pressure you into purchasing unnecessary products or services. They will also be certified and insured to work in your locality.
If you're not sure whom to call, you can ask your family and friends for suggestions. You can also look up online reviews to find out the way other customers have handled their experience. You can also contact a local locksmith association to get more details.
Some locksmiths are experts in specific car brands and models. Others provide a wider selection of services. Some will even visit you, which could be a lifesaver in an emergency situation. Some will charge extra for travel expenses but it could be worth it in some instances. If you're on a strict budget, search for auto locksmiths who offer competitive rates.

Key Fobs that have been stolen or lost
Modern car keys are more convenient secure, reliable and durable than ever before. However, this convenience comes with cost In the event that you lose your keys you'll have to contact an automotive locksmith to have another set up. The exact cost for this service will differ based on the year, make, and model of your vehicle.
You may be able create a replacement fob by yourself depending on the model and make of your vehicle. Many automakers have instructions for the process in their owner's manuals and you can also find information on the internet. These procedures are tedious and time-consuming. Most people call a locksmith to help them.
If you have a key fob that was either lost or stolen it is possible to get it replaced by your local auto dealer. It's crucial to keep in mind that dealerships typically require you to pay for key programming services, which can be costly.
The best way to avoid having to pay extra on replacement fobs for keys is to always have another fob on hand to be prepared in the event of. It's a good idea purchase a spare key fob from your dealer or another retailer who sells keys for cars when you buy your car.
If you already have two functioning keys and you want to save money, you can do so by having a professional locksmith create a third one for you. Many vehicle brands allow this, but the procedure varies by manufacturer and can be difficult to locate online or in your owner's manual.
A key tracker is another option. It makes use of Bluetooth to sync your phone with the device and shows you where your keys are. These aren't completely secure as hackers could make use of a device that amplifies the key fob's signal to trick the car into believing that it is being activated. As long as manufacturers don't find a better solution such trackers are an affordable option that will assist you in keeping track of your keys.
